Childhood Bipolar Disorder: A Treatable Disease

Published by Jennifer under Bipolar Disorder

Many people have heard about bipolar disorder or as it is sometimes referred maniac depression. However, many may not be aware that this is a disease that can occur in childhood.  Childhood bipolar disorder can be seen in children as young as infants, or it can begin in adolescences.

From Past to Present: A History of Bipolar Disorder

Published by Jennifer under Bipolar Disorder

It has only been recently that the term “bipolar disorder” has been coined to represent what has always been a misunderstood condition.  The ancient Greeks knew of it, and the ancient Chinese even wrote about it in an encyclopedia.  Yet, it was only in 1957 that the terms “bipolar” and “unipolar” were even used.

Not Child’s Play: Supporting Children with Pediatric Bipolar Disorder

Published by Jennifer under Bipolar Disorder

Bipolar disorder does not only affect adults, it plagues thousands of teenagers and children as well.  Children with pediatric disorder display symptoms distinctly different than those that adults show, and they are frequently misdiagnosed several times before pediatric bipolar disorder is finally recognized.
